
Mark Cavendish won the final stage of the Tour of California in a sprint finish, and Julian Alaphilippe finished safely in the field to capture the overall title Sunday. The breakaway had 35 seconds on the flat, fast stage with about 2 miles left on the 86-mile route, but it was caught by a main field powered by Peter Sagan's Tinkoff team and Alexander Kristoff's Katusha squad. Cavendish, who excels on flat finishes, was able to outsprint both powerhouses to win his first stage in this year's race and the 10th of his career in California.
